Comprehending Your Canine's Individuality
Just how well do you truly recognize your pet's personality? Recognizing your pet's unique characteristics is essential prior to presenting them to daycare.
Observe exactly how they connect with other pets and individuals. Are they social butterflies or even more booked? Take notice of their energy degrees-- do they grow in energetic atmospheres or choose calm setups? Knowing whether your dog is lively, nervous, or leading helps you choose the right daycare that matches their demands.
It's additionally essential to consider their reactions to unfamiliar circumstances; some canines adapt rapidly, while others may require time. Recognizing these qualities will certainly relieve the shift and ensure a favorable experience.
Researching daycare Facilities
When you have actually obtained a good understanding of your dog's character, it's time to study day care facilities that fit their demands. Beginning by asking pals, family members, or your vet for referrals.
Try to find areas that focus on your pet dog's type or dimension, as some centers cater to particular kinds. Examine on-line evaluations and ratings to determine other pet proprietors' experiences.
Take notice of the center's security protocols, cleanliness, and staff certifications. Ensure they've a structured routine that includes playtime, remainder, and socializing.
Don't neglect to ask about their policies on vaccinations and health checks. This foundation will certainly aid you find a day care that ensures your canine really feels comfortable and happy while you're away.

Gradual Introductions to the Atmosphere
To aid your pet feel comfortable in a new day care setting, start with steady intros that enable them to acclimate at their own speed.
Begin by taking short sees to the daycare, allowing your dog discover the area while you exist. This helps them associate the environment with favorable experiences.
Slowly raise the period of these check outs, enabling your dog to wander and examine. You could likewise let them have fun with a favorite plaything or receive deals with to create a favorable link.
Focus on their body movement; if they seem anxious, take a go back and permit even more time before trying once more.
This slow-moving technique constructs their confidence and makes the change smoother for both of you.
Socialization With Other Pet dogs
As you prepare your canine for daycare, socialization with various other canines plays an essential role in their total convenience and happiness.
Begin by preparing playdates with pleasant, well-behaved pets. This will certainly help your pup find out just how to connect and communicate with their peers in a regulated environment. Observe their body language and interfere if play gets as well rough.
Slowly boost the number of dogs during these encounters, enabling your dog to construct confidence and learn proper social signs. Familiarize them with different breeds and dimensions, as this variety can relieve any stress and anxiety about sharing room with unknown dogs.
Positive experiences will establish the stage for a smoother change to daycare, guaranteeing your pet feels relaxed and protect among their brand-new canine companions.
Readying Your Pet for the First Day
When the big day shows up, you'll intend to guarantee your pet really feels all set and certain for their very first daycare experience.
Start by taking your canine on a couple of brows through to the center ahead of time. Let them discover the area and meet the staff. This familiarity can reduce anxiety.
On the day of day care, keep the early morning regular consistent to aid your pet feel protected. Pack a favorite toy or blanket in their bag to give comfort.
If your dog has special demands or choices, connect these to the staff.
Lastly, consider a short, favorable goodbye to set a calm tone. Your favorable energy will aid your canine feel extra kicked back and prepared to embrace this brand-new adventure.
Monitoring Your Canine's Behavior
While your canine is at day care, it's essential to check their behavior very closely to guarantee they're adjusting well to the new environment.
Take note of just how they connect with various other pets and personnel. Are they spirited and energetic, or do they appear taken out and distressed? Try to find indications of stress, such as extreme barking, pacing, or hiding. These habits could show that your pet isn't comfy yet.
If they appear reluctant, it might be worth thinking about shorter sees at first to help them accommodate. Watch on their power degrees and hunger, as adjustments can indicate discomfort.
On a regular basis observing your pet during this transition will help you gauge their comfort and joy in the day care setup.

Adjusting to the New Regimen
As your pet starts attending daycare, it's necessary to help them adapt to this brand-new regimen. Beginning by establishing a consistent schedule for drop-offs and pick-ups. Dogs grow on routine, so try to adhere to the exact same times daily.
Progressively enhance the period of their remain, allowing them to acclimate to the setting without overwhelming them. Strengthen favorable experiences by compensating them with treats or applaud when they return home.
Watch on their actions; if they appear anxious, take into consideration much shorter sees initially. Additionally, offer them with a preferred plaything or blanket to provide convenience.
With patience and consistency, your canine will certainly quickly welcome this new routine and anticipate their time at daycare.
